AirDate: 2/5/2023 |
Overview: Forensic pathologists take a closer look at the final hours of Owen Hart's life. |
Owen HartShow: Autopsy: The Last Hours of... --> Season: 11 - Season 11
AirDate: 2/5/2023
|
Overview: Forensic pathologists take a closer look at the final hours of Owen Hart's life. |